Buford
BYOO-ferd
Buford is a boy’s name of English origin, meaning “Derived from an English surname, of uncertain origin, possibly meaning 'lives near the ford of the Bucca' (a personal name).”, and peaked in popularity in 1921.

The Story of Buford
A name born from English trails and American grit, Buford echoes with a quiet strength that feels destined for your son.
Buford likely emerged from an English surname, possibly stemming from 'Bucca's ford,' referring to a crossing point named after an ancient personal name. This name traveled with settlers across the Atlantic, finding a particular resonance in the American South and Midwest. It became associated with rugged individualism and a steadfast character, gaining prominence in the late 19th and early 20th centuries as a given name.
